  3. History of the garotte (or garrotte) - Capital Punishment U.K

    www.capitalpunishmentuk.org/garrotte.html

    The garrotte (or garrote) was the standard civilian method of execution in Spain. It was introduced in 1812/13, at the beginning of the reign of Ferdinand VII , to replace the crude form of hanging previously used. At least 736 people, including 16 women, were executed in Spain in the 19th …
